13.12 VOICE QUALITY CERTIFICATIONS

Voice quality certification is a very important action for promoting the solutions. Several focused categories for voice quality certification exist. The main are given here:

  • Agencies like American Telephone and Telegraph (ATT) and British Telecom certify for echo canceller and overall listening quality. This is mainly for voice aspects and not for the complete VoIP product.
  • The Telecommunication Technology Association (TTA) [www.tta.or.kr] tests [URL (TTA)] and certifies for voice and several networking functions. Usually the tests are conducted on 50 different signaling and voice operations and their parameters.
  • The Tolly Group [URL (Tolly)] also conducts a certification program called the “VoIP capable infrastructure (Quality of Service),” which verifies the device under test's quality-of-service (QoS) mechanisms. It can adequately support latency-sensitive applications such as voice in a congested environment by providing sufficiently low latency as well as voice quality scores that are coincident with those deemed toll quality [www.tolly.com].
  • There are some test agencies for fax over IP testing such as Commetrex Corporation [www.commetrex.com].
  • CT Labs [www.ct-labs.com] also conducts several stress and voice quality tests.

The test agencies and testing support may change over time based on the time-sensitive requirements. Therefore, refer to the latest information on test agencies.
